我的Telerik报告存在问题。
我在trdx文件中定义了主报表。它包含子报表,也在trdx文件中定义。在设计师工作得很好,但当我把这个报告放在我的网站上时,我收到一个错误:"An error has occurred while processing SubReport 'company_address': Could not find file 'something\Organizers.trdx'. "
它正在我的Web应用程序的默认工作目录中搜索报告,但是我将报告ID存储在不同的文件夹中。我可以通过编程方式更改吗?我不想在设计器中硬编码子报告的路径(我不知道它是否可能)。
关于我如何使用这些报告的几句话。我有ASP.NET应用程序。我扫描给定文件夹中的所有* .trdx文件,然后使用ReportXmlSerializer对它们进行反序列化。除了包含子报告的报告外,一切正常。
您是否知道如果报告有子报告,我怎样才能更改子报告的路径?